Our Heritage

More than 75 years ago, Reverend J. T. Edwards of Culpeper, VA, dreamed of establishing a residential community to care for older adults. His dream was realized in 1945, when the Baptist General Association of Virginia voted to open a senior living community in Culpeper, the very first Virginia Baptist home. Thus Virginia Baptist Homes, now LifeSpire of Virginia, was born. Through the years, our organization has grown to include four faith-based, nonprofit communities: The Culpeper in Culpeper, Lakewood in Richmond, The Glebe in Daleville, and The Chesapeake in Newport News.

Located in the heart of the Virginia Peninsula, The Chesapeake, formerly The Newport News Baptist Retirement Community, continues the vision of our founder, Reverend J.T. Edwards, whose dream was to provide residential communities where seniors could enjoy the finest in retirement living.
